Why Choose a 16 Gauge Kitchen Sink?
Before diving into the top picks, it’s important to understand why 16 gauge sinks stand out.
- Thicker steel (≈1.5mm): Stronger and more durable
- Better noise reduction: Less clanging from dishes
- Dent-resistant: Ideal for heavy cookware
- Premium quality: Often used in high-end kitchens

How to Choose the Best 16 Gauge Kitchen Sink
Here are a few factors to consider before buying:
1. Size and Configuration
- Single bowl → more space for large pots
- Double bowl → better for multitasking
2. Mount Type
- Undermount → modern, easy to clean
- Drop-in → easier installation
3. Depth
- 9–10 inches = ideal range
- Deeper sinks reduce splashing
4. Accessories
- Workstation sinks add versatility
- Consider if you need cutting boards or racks

FAQs About 16 Gauge Kitchen Sinks
What is the best 16 gauge kitchen sink?
The Kraus KHU100-32 is widely considered the best overall due to its balance of price, durability, and performance.
Is 16 gauge too heavy?
Not really, but it is heavier than 18 gauge. Most standard cabinets can support it.
Do 16 gauge sinks scratch easily?
All stainless steel sinks can scratch, but brushed finishes help hide marks.
How long does a 16 gauge sink last?
With proper care, it can last 10–20 years or more.
